Understanding plan fees is important for managing your investments and optimizing returns. This post provides an overview of common plan fees, how they are calculated, and tips for minimizing costs, supporting your long-term financial goals.
Common plan fees include administrative charges, investment management fees, and service costs. Reviewing fee schedules, comparing options, and consulting with financial professionals helps identify opportunities to reduce expenses and maximize value.
Transparency in fee disclosures empowers clients to make informed decisions and avoid unexpected costs. Regular reviews and updates to fee structures ensure alignment with changing needs and market conditions.
In summary, understanding plan fees is essential for financial success. By reviewing disclosures, seeking clarity, and staying proactive, you can manage costs effectively and build a strong investment strategy.
